Buying Guide: Choosing the Right Slip Roller for Your Shop

Selecting the best slip roller for your sheet metal shop requires matching machine capabilities to your typical workload. The 12 machines covered above span entry-level hobby equipment to professional production tools, and the right choice depends on five key factors.

Manual vs Electric Slip Rollers

Manual slip rollers use a hand crank to drive the forming rollers, which gives you complete control over feed speed and pressure. For most sheet metal shops handling 20 to 24-gauge mild steel, a quality manual roller like the Baileigh SR-1220M or VEVOR 12.6 inch model delivers all the performance you need at a fraction of the cost of powered alternatives.

Electric slip rollers make sense for high-volume production environments where an operator would be cranking for hours at a time. They also handle thicker materials more easily, since the motor provides consistent torque regardless of operator fatigue. For shops rolling 50+ pieces per day, the productivity gains justify the higher capital cost.

For most small to medium shops, manual rollers offer the best balance of capability and value. The Baileigh SR-1220M and KAKA Industrial W01-2422 represent the sweet spot of manual roller capability for professional work.

Gauge Capacity and Material Thickness

Manufacturer gauge ratings can be misleading. A roller rated for 20-gauge mild steel will handle 22-gauge with ease, but pushing to 18-gauge may produce kinking or surface defects. For the best slip rollers for sheet metal shops handling production work, choose a machine with at least 25% more capacity than your typical workload.

Consider the materials you work with most often. Mild steel requires more force than aluminum of the same thickness. Stainless steel work-hardens during forming, which limits achievable bend radii. Copper and brass form easily but show surface marks from roller texture more readily than other materials.

For HVAC contractors working primarily with 22 to 24-gauge galvanized steel, a 20-gauge rated roller provides adequate headroom. For automotive restoration involving 18-gauge patch panels, step up to a heavier machine like the KAKA Industrial W01-2422.

Forming Width and Roll Diameter

Forming width determines the maximum width of sheet metal the roller can accommodate. 12-inch rollers handle most residential HVAC and small fabrication work. 24-inch rollers like the KAKA W01-2422 handle architectural sheet metal, aircraft panels, and automotive quarter panels without seams.

Roll diameter affects the minimum forming radius. Larger diameter rolls produce gentler curves, while smaller diameter rolls can produce tighter bends. The Baileigh SR-1220M with its 1.5-inch rolls achieves a 1.6-inch minimum rolling diameter, while larger rollers may be limited to 3-inch minimum diameters.

For shops that need both tight curves and wide capacity, a machine with independently adjustable back rolls offers more versatility. The Baileigh SR-1220M excels here with its cone-forming capability.

Construction Quality and Frame Materials

Cast iron frames resist flex and hold alignment better than welded steel frames. The HT200 cast iron used in KAKA Industrial machines exceeds ASTM standards for rigidity, which translates to more accurate results and longer service life. Baileigh machines use similar heavy cast construction in their premium models.

Hardened steel rollers outlast mild steel rollers in production environments. Precision-ground rollers produce smoother surface finishes on formed parts, which matters for visible architectural and automotive applications.

Check the gear train quality. Hardened, ground gears hold their precision longer than softer, machined gears. The Baileigh SR-1220M uses hardened gears that have proven their longevity over decades of production use.

Wire Grooves and Quick Release Features

Wire forming grooves built into the rollers let you produce consistent curves in round bar and wire without a separate bender. Common groove sizes cover 1/8 to 3/8 inch diameter rod. For shops that work with both sheet metal and wire components, this dual capability saves space and capital.

Quick-release top rollers swing out to allow easy removal of closed cylinders. This feature is essential for producing tube sections, pressure vessel components, and any rolled part that forms a complete loop. The Baileigh SR-1220M and KAKA Industrial W01-2422 both include this capability.

For shops producing cones, tapered cylinders, or asymmetric shapes, look for machines with independently adjustable back rolls. This feature is rare in budget rollers but standard in professional machines.

Shop Size and Production Volume Considerations

Small shops with limited bench space benefit from compact machines like the VEVOR 12.6 inch roller or the MARKETTY ER3 edge roller. Both deliver professional results while occupying minimal floor space.

Mid-size shops handling 10-20 rolling projects per week need machines with higher capacity and faster setup. The KAKA Industrial 3-IN-1/12 or Baileigh SR-1220M balance capability with footprint effectively.

Production environments running dedicated rolling operations throughout the day need industrial-grade machines. While none of the 12 machines in this guide are truly industrial, the Baileigh models come closest to production-ready construction.

Frequently Asked Questions

What are the different types of sheet metal rollers?

Three main types dominate the sheet metal roller market. Manual slip rollers use a hand crank and are the most affordable, making them ideal for small shops and hobbyists. Powered slip rollers add an electric motor for production environments with higher volume. Combination machines integrate shear, brake, and slip roll functions in one unit, saving shop space at the cost of slower changeover between operations. Within each type, you will find variations in forming width (typically 8 to 48 inches), gauge capacity (usually 16 to 22 gauge for mild steel), and construction quality ranging from budget cast aluminum to industrial cast iron.

What are the common problems with a sheet metal roller?

The most frequent issue is material kinking, which happens when the rollers are misaligned or when you exceed the rated gauge capacity. Surface marking from knurled rollers affects polished materials but is cosmetic only. Loose adjustment hardware causes inconsistent bend radii and is easily fixed with thread-locking compound. Binding during operation usually indicates insufficient lubrication at the Zerk fittings or debris in the gear train. Shipping damage is common with budget machines, so inspect thoroughly before use. Finally, capacity confusion causes many beginners to push materials beyond rated limits, which damages the drive mechanism and rollers over time.

How much does a sheet metal roller cost?

Sheet metal roller prices span a wide range based on capability and build quality. Entry-level manual rollers like the VEVOR 12.6 inch start around $110 and handle light-duty work. Mid-range manual rollers with cast iron construction run $200 to $500 and cover most small shop needs. Professional manual rollers from Baileigh start around $275 and deliver precision performance. Combination machines that integrate shear, brake, and roll functions typically cost $240 to $500. Powered slip rollers for production environments start around $2,000 and can exceed $7,000 for industrial capacity. For most small to medium shops, a quality manual roller in the $200 to $500 range delivers the best value.

What is a sheet metal slip roller?

A sheet metal slip roller is a metal forming machine that bends flat sheet stock into cylindrical or curved shapes. It uses three rollers positioned on parallel axes, with the top roller applying adjustable downward pressure on the material as it feeds between the bottom two rollers. The operator cranks a handle to drive the rollers, gradually bending the sheet as it passes through. By adjusting the roller spacing and feed angle, you can produce cylinders, cones, tapered sections, and curved panels for HVAC, automotive, architectural, and industrial applications. Slip rollers are essential equipment for any shop that produces curved metal components.
